免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
查看: 1354 | 回复: 5
打印 上一主题 下一主题

oracle字符集问题探讨 [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2003-12-25 12:55 |只看该作者 |倒序浏览
oracle字符集问题一直以来是一个困扰oracle用户的常见问题。对于这个问题的解决办法也有很多文章,但这些文章并不能解决所有的字符集问题。
字符集问题主要涉及到服务端:操作系统字符集、数据库字符集,客户端:操作系统字符集、数据库字符集等等,特别是涉及到开发应用程序的字符集等问题。
这些字符集怎样更改呢?假如说,客户端是linux,客户端字符集有几个地方需要注意?等等,希望集合大家的力量,形成一个最终的oracle字符集的解决文档。

论坛徽章:
0
2 [报告]
发表于 2003-12-25 13:01 |只看该作者

oracle字符集问题探讨

支持!
顶!

论坛徽章:
0
3 [报告]
发表于 2003-12-25 13:19 |只看该作者

oracle字符集问题探讨

支持,客户端 数据库系统 操作系统 三者的字符集必须一致

论坛徽章:
0
4 [报告]
发表于 2003-12-25 17:18 |只看该作者

oracle字符集问题探讨

晓得要一致,可具体如何设置呢

论坛徽章:
0
5 [报告]
发表于 2003-12-25 17:32 |只看该作者

oracle字符集问题探讨

字符集不一至会导致数据转换,在数据转换过程中可能产生数据丢失。
比如在字符集A中有,但是在字符集B中没有的数字符,在A向B中转换时就可能丢失。存为为”?“或相近的字符。
数据库的字符集最好是客户端操作系统字符集的超集或平集。这样就可以保证进行字符转换时所有的客户端字符都可以转换到数据库字符。

论坛徽章:
0
6 [报告]
发表于 2003-12-25 17:41 |只看该作者

oracle字符集问题探讨

尝试用如下方法:
注册表HKEY_LOCAL_MACHINE
   -  ->;SOFTWARE-->;  ORACLE--中的NLS_LANG  的数据值
西文:  AMERICAN_AMERICA.WE8ISO8859P1
中文:SIMPLIFIED CHINESE_CHINA.ZHS16CGB231280
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P